French Silk Pie - 430 calories

Manufacturer Wal-mart Stores, Inc.

Product Information and Ingredients

French Silk Pie is manufactured by Wal-mart Stores, Inc. with a suggested serving size of 0.17 PIE (99 g) and 430 calories per serving. The nutritional value of a suggested serving of french silk pie includes 70 mg of cholesterol, 0 mg of sodium, 37 grams of carbohydrates, 1 grams of dietary fiber, 23 grams of sugar and 3 grams of proteins.

The product's manufacturer code is UPC: 078742277042.

This product is high in fat, sugars and saturated fats.

Calories from fat: a total of 62.79% of the total calories in this suggested serving come from fat. Try to consume less than 10 percent of daily calories from saturated fats.

Dietary Recommendations

A healthy eating pattern that accounts for all foods and beverages within an appropriate calorie level could help achieve and maintain a healthy weight and reduce the risk of chronic disease. Healthy eating habits include the following:

  • Vegetables from all subgroups, including dark, green, red and orange vegetables and also beans and peas
  • A variety of whole fruits
  • Grains with at least half of which are whole grains
  • Low or fat free dairy products, including milk, yogurt, cheese and/or fortified soy beverages
  • Protein foods, including seafood, lean meats and poultry, eggs and nuts
  • Oils with limited amounts of saturated fats and trans fats, added sugars, and sodium
